Standard Framework Scaffolding
Conventional structure scaffolding is just one of one of the most commonly utilized techniques in the building and construction industry because of its effectiveness and adaptability. This system contains horizontal and upright frames that are constructed to produce a stable system for products and employees. The primary parts include vertical posts, straight journals, and diagonal braces, which together supply a solid framework that can sustain substantial tons.
Among the key advantages of typical structure scaffolding is its adaptability to various building projects, varying from residential structures to large industrial frameworks. The modular design allows for simple assembly and disassembly, making it reliable for both long-term and short-term projects. In addition, the system can be tailored in height and size, accommodating various building styles and site problems.
Safety is extremely important in scaffolding applications, and typical framework systems are geared up with guardrails and toe boards to prevent falls and guarantee worker defense. Regular inspections and adherence to safety and security regulations are vital in maintaining the honesty of the scaffold (Scaffolding). Generally, typical framework scaffolding remains a fundamental option in the construction market, giving a trustworthy system for labor and improving total project performance

Suspended Scaffolding
Put on hold scaffolding offers an one-of-a-kind option for building projects that require accessibility to elevated surfaces, particularly in situations where typical frame scaffolding might be unwise. This sort of scaffolding is generally suspended from the roof or upper degrees of a structure, using a system of platforms, pulleys, and ropes to produce a working room that can be gotten used to various elevations.
Among the main advantages of put on hold scaffolding is its versatility. It can be quickly rearranged or lowered to fit changes in building needs, making it suitable for jobs such as home window installment, frontage job, and upkeep on skyscraper structures. Furthermore, the minimal footprint of suspended scaffolding permits for far better use ground space in city settings, where space is often restricted.
Security is a vital consideration in the use of put on hold scaffolding. Generally, suspended scaffolding gives a efficient and efficient service for accessing hard-to-reach areas in various building scenarios, boosting both performance and security on website.

Rolling Scaffolding
Rolling scaffolding is a flexible option to standard fixed scaffolding, designed for flexibility and convenience of usage on construction sites. This kind of scaffolding contains a platform sustained by structures with wheels, allowing employees to conveniently move it as required. The mobility attribute significantly boosts performance, as it decreases downtime associated with assembling and disassembling repaired scaffolding.
Usually constructed from light-weight products such as aluminum or steel, rolling scaffolding offers a sturdy yet mobile option for jobs requiring frequent repositioning - Scaffolding. It is specifically useful in tasks such as painting, drywall installation, and electrical work, where accessibility to numerous elevations and places is required
Safety and security is critical in rolling scaffolding style, with features such as securing wheels to avoid unplanned activity when being used, and guardrails to shield employees from falls. In addition, many versions are flexible in height, fitting different job requirements.
